本文目录导读:
什么是代码托管
代码托管,又称代码仓库,是指用于存放和共享源代码的服务平台,开发者可以通过代码托管平台进行代码的版本控制、协同开发、项目管理和团队协作等操作,代码托管平台具有以下几个特点:
1、版本控制:通过版本控制,开发者可以追踪代码的修改历史,回滚到之前的版本,避免因误操作导致的数据丢失。
2、协同开发:多个开发者可以在同一代码仓库中协作,实现代码的合并和同步。
3、项目管理:代码托管平台提供项目管理功能,包括任务分配、进度跟踪、文档管理、代码审查等。
图片来源于网络,如有侵权联系删除
4、团队协作:代码托管平台支持多人协作,便于团队成员之间的沟通和交流。
代码托管平台的功能
1、代码存储:将源代码存储在云端,方便团队成员随时访问和修改。
2、版本控制:支持Git、SVN等主流版本控制工具,实现代码的版本管理。
3、代码审查:提供代码审查功能,确保代码质量,降低bug率。
4、自动化构建:支持自动化构建、测试和部署,提高开发效率。
5、权限管理:对代码仓库进行权限设置,确保代码安全。
6、项目管理:提供任务分配、进度跟踪、文档管理等功能,助力项目顺利推进。
图片来源于网络,如有侵权联系删除
7、团队协作:支持多人协作,便于团队成员之间的沟通和交流。
代码托管平台的优势
1、高效协同:代码托管平台支持多人协作,提高开发效率。
2、代码安全:云端存储,防止数据丢失,保障代码安全。
3、版本控制:方便追踪代码修改历史,回滚到之前的版本。
4、代码审查:降低bug率,提高代码质量。
5、自动化构建:提高开发效率,降低人力成本。
6、项目管理:助力项目顺利推进,提高团队协作能力。
图片来源于网络,如有侵权联系删除
代码托管平台的应用场景
1、个人项目:开发者可以将个人项目托管在代码托管平台上,方便进行版本控制和协作。
2、企业项目:企业可以将内部项目托管在代码托管平台上,实现团队协作和项目管理。
3、开源项目:开源项目开发者可以利用代码托管平台进行协作,促进项目发展。
4、教育培训:教师和学生可以借助代码托管平台进行教学和实训,提高编程能力。
5、第三方服务:第三方开发者可以将服务代码托管在代码托管平台上,方便用户获取和更新。
代码托管平台是现代软件开发不可或缺的工具,通过代码托管平台,开发者可以实现高效协同、保障代码安全、提高代码质量,助力项目顺利推进,随着云计算和互联网技术的不断发展,代码托管平台将在软件开发领域发挥越来越重要的作用。
标签: #什么是代码托管
评论列表